Spanish Moss Trail Parking - Westvine - Featured Reviews (137)
A complete package. Great views through most of the trail, shaded most of the way, you'll pass a drive in movie theater, and if you are feel up to it, the first 2 miles are kind of made up as you go. I never did find the first two miles, but I did head to Sands beach and through a virtual jungle. It was great
Great trail through some beautiful country. Great overlooks into the low country, easy ride to the north trailhead. Had a few spots through some homeless areas and the intersection of Hwy 116 Laurel Bay Road can be dangerous on your first outing. On and off ramps have some fast traffic.
Nice trail and parking. It would be fun to have a place along the trail to stop and get coffee. You can walk or bike, no motorized vehicles.
My family and love it. Nice paved trail. What is missing is restrooms.
Really nice 11.5 mile paved multi-use trail. Flat and great views of the low country off road. Parking very useful! Bike tools & air as well. There is also a workout area of some kind that I didn't look at.
Rode my bike from Port Royal to Clarenden. Great canopy, very safe from vehicles. North end is rarely used, great for cyclists.
Great parking spot if you don't plan on bringing a dog. I parked here and had my dog with. We got maybe 3/4 a mile on the trail and walked by a house without a fence and dogs in the yard. They did come back when the owners called when we passed. However, on our way back the owners were not in the yard. Luckily they left us alone. I love this trail but will not park here again due to that issue. This section of the trail is pretty quite though and was a mixture of shade and sun.
